Here’s a little secret, though: “Creativity” can be a loaded word, even for creatives. Many of us, who work in what are known as creative fields (marketing, advertising, editorial, filmmaking and the like) simply feel too modest or intimidated to identify as such. We think, ‘That person over there is much more innovative than me. He’s the real creative.’

Well, marketing maven Ann Handley sees it differently.
